Handover: Pixelbin image cache leak

Leak confirmed in the thumbnail eviction path — refs held past TTL. Repro on staging box korvat-3 under sustained upload load. Heap dumps in the Pixelbin diag bucket. Fix branch half done; eviction rewrite pending. To pull the encrypted dumps you'll need the diag archive passphrase, noted immediately below.

strongbox words: fenwyn-tamys-norys-lamius-gilion-gilath

## Approvals for Plugin Submissions

All external plugins for the Gaugefire GPU memory profiler must pass the allocation-hook compatibility suite before review. Submissions touching the sampler core require an additional architecture note. Expect one review cycle per week; resubmissions re-enter the queue. Final approval authority for all third-party plugins rests with the maintainer named below.

account owner for bawip-tahag: Raleth Quenok

GROSS-MARGIN REVIEW — Q2 SUMMARY

Margin on the Corvalon line slipped 2.1 points, driven by freight and the Ostermead plant changeover. Kittiver series held flat. Pricing actions approved in April recovered roughly half the erosion; the rest lands in Q3.

Heads of department: cost-reduction targets are unchanged. No discretionary spend increases until the Delvaux retooling completes. Full workbook circulates Friday.

One item is for this distribution only, and it follows here.

confidential, kagup-bafog: Fraaxax Group is in early talks to buy Soroxox Group for about $343.8 million. The Olidor launch date is June 14, and nothing goes to the press before then. Legal wants the Aldmirek Logistics term sheet signed before July 23.

So, the markdown pipeline. Pressfern takes raw author markdown, runs it through the sanitizer, then our custom extension pass (callouts, footnotes, the weird table syntax marketing loves), and finally the HTML renderer with caching. Most bugs live in the extension pass — touch it carefully and run the golden-file tests. Cache invalidation is keyed on content hash plus renderer version, so bump the version when output changes. Architecture notes are on the page below.

runbook for badug-kadup: https://confluence.zemvarlabs.internal/projects/browse/display/projects/bd1b